
Learn to build Web Apps with Next.js. You will cover Routing, Navigation, Pages, Layouts, SSR, Data Fetching and more
β±οΈ Length: 9.9 total hours
β 4.59/5 rating
π₯ 8,154 students
π October 2025 update
Add-On Information:
Noteβ Make sure your ππππ¦π² cart has only this course you're going to enroll it now, Remove all other courses from the ππππ¦π² cart before Enrolling!
- Course Overview
- Embark on an accelerated journey into the world of modern web development with the Next.js Crash Course: Build a Full-Stack App in a Weekend.
- This intensive program is meticulously designed for developers eager to rapidly acquire proficiency in building robust and performant web applications using the leading React framework.
- In just under 10 hours, you’ll transition from foundational knowledge to confidently deploying a complete, server-rendered application, mirroring the structure and capabilities of real-world projects.
- The course focuses on practical application, guiding you through the creation of a visually appealing and functional contacts list application, serving as a tangible outcome of your weekend learning endeavor.
- With an impressive average rating of 4.59/5, this course has empowered over 8,154 students to level up their frontend and backend development skills, validated by its recent update in October 2025.
- Itβs more than just a tutorial; itβs a comprehensive bootcamp that equips you with the essential tools and conceptual understanding to tackle complex web development challenges.
- The curriculum emphasizes a hands-on approach, ensuring that every concept learned is immediately reinforced through practical implementation, fostering deep understanding and skill retention.
- You will not just learn *how* to build, but also *why* certain architectural decisions are made in Next.js, providing a strategic advantage in your development career.
- Requirements / Prerequisites
- A foundational understanding of JavaScript is essential, including concepts like variables, data types, functions, and basic asynchronous programming.
- Familiarity with React.js fundamentals, such as components, props, state management, and the component lifecycle, will significantly enhance your learning experience.
- Basic knowledge of HTML and CSS is expected, as these are the building blocks of any web interface.
- A working computer with internet access capable of running development tools and a modern web browser is a necessity.
- No prior experience with Next.js is required, making this course accessible to those new to the framework.
- A desire to learn and a willingness to dedicate focused time over a weekend to achieve rapid skill acquisition.
- Comfort with using a command-line interface (CLI) for project setup and management.
- Basic understanding of version control systems like Git is beneficial but not strictly mandatory.
- Skills Covered / Tools Used
- Master the core principles of Next.js architecture and its server-side rendering (SSR) capabilities.
- Gain practical experience with Next.js routing mechanisms, enabling seamless navigation within your applications.
- Develop proficiency in structuring and organizing your project using Next.js page-based routing and component-based layouts.
- Learn to implement effective data fetching strategies tailored for both server and client environments within Next.js.
- Understand the nuances of dynamic routing and how to manage variable URLs and deep linking.
- Explore techniques for styling Next.js applications, ensuring visually appealing and responsive user interfaces.
- Gain insight into building reusable and maintainable UI components.
- Acquire skills in optimizing application performance through Next.js features.
- Learn debugging techniques specific to Next.js applications.
- Become familiar with the underlying principles that make Next.js a powerful framework for modern web development.
- Benefits / Outcomes
- You will possess the ability to independently build and deploy full-stack web applications using Next.js within a short timeframe.
- Gain a competitive edge in the job market by adding a highly sought-after skill in modern frontend development.
- Be equipped to create more performant and SEO-friendly websites due to Next.js’s SSR capabilities.
- Develop the confidence to tackle complex frontend architecture and project setups.
- Enhance your problem-solving skills through practical application and debugging exercises.
- The ability to create a portfolio-worthy project by the end of the weekend, showcasing your newfound skills.
- Understand how to leverage the React ecosystem within a framework context for rapid development.
- Empowerment to choose the right tools and patterns for your next web development project.
- A solid foundation for further exploration into advanced Next.js features and related technologies.
- PROS
- Rapid Skill Acquisition: Designed for quick learning, making it ideal for those with limited time.
- Practical, Project-Based Learning: Focuses on building a real-world app, reinforcing concepts effectively.
- High-Quality Content: Excellent rating and substantial student base suggest well-delivered material.
- Comprehensive Coverage: Touches upon essential full-stack aspects relevant to Next.js.
- Up-to-Date Material: Regular updates ensure relevance in a fast-evolving tech landscape.
- CONS
- Intensive Pacing: The “crash” nature might be overwhelming for absolute beginners to web development or React.
Learning Tracks: English,Development,Web Development
Found It Free? Share It Fast!